  • The electric conductivities of aqueous solutions of rubidium and cesium cyclohexylsulfamates, potassium acesulfame and sodium saccharin
    Rudan Tasič, Darja ; Klofutar, Cveto ; Bešter-Rogač, Marija
    The electric conductivities of aqueous solutions of rubidium and cesium salts of cyclohexylsulfamic acid, potassium acesulfame and sodium saccharin were measured from 5 °C to 35 °C (in steps of 5 °C) ... in the concentration range 0.0003 < c/mol dm-3 < 0.01. Data analysis based on the chemical model of electroyte solutions yielded the limiting molar conductivity .. and the association constant KA. Using the known data of the limiting conductivities of rubidium, cesium, sodium and potassium ions the limiting conductivities of the cyclohexylsulfamate, accesulfame and saccharin ions were evaluated. Total dissociation of the investigated salts in water and negligible hydration of anions are evident.
